Font Size: a A A

Study Of Optimization Method For An Embedded Data Storage System

Posted on:2014-07-30Degree:MasterType:Thesis
Country:ChinaCandidate:S ChenFull Text:PDF
GTID:2308330467474871Subject:Physical Electronics
Abstract/Summary:PDF Full Text Request
In recent years, with the increasing demand, the rate of data acquisition system i s demanded as fast as possible in many wild collective areas,such as astronomical ob servations, geological exploration, environmental monitoring, air satellite and so on. In recent years, with the increasing demand, the rate of data acquisition system is de manded as fast as possible in many wild collective areas,such as astronomical observ ations, geological exploration, environmental monitoring, air satellite and so on. whil e the faster acquisition rate,the highier rate requirements of the embedded data trans mission and storage systems.a lower power consumption embedded devices required cause a long time continuous work requirements within the harsh environment of fi eld work which proved to be more often.Therefore, under the basic premise of the lo w-power,we hope that the speed of embedded data transmission and storage system operating as high as possible. Based on this, this thesis set of a low-power embedded data transmission and storage system.This system uses highly integrated STM32F407microcontroller which having a low-power and high-performance to ensure that the system performance and low po wer consumption. The system uses fast Ethernet to long-distance data transmission via USB2.0high-speed interface for fast data storage and via using non-volatile stora ge medium U disk to achieve a flexible large-capacity removable data storage.。 in the low power consumption, the main reason of the slower network transmission spe ed of traditional embedded system is the network protocol unefficiency according to a low performance embedded system, this is also the difficulties we need to addres s。In this paper we agure that the system applied in a simple peer-to-peer network e nvironment, through improving embedded network protocol stack Implementation L wIP which in common used base on the idea of data zero-copy can improve the perfo rmance of network transmission.This system is a common set of general-purpose em bedded data transmission and storage system, under the base of the low-power consu mption acciving a high-performance in transmission and storage, which will have an practical value in many areas.The paper focuses on these following problems:1. a detailed presention respectively on the entirety program design of low-power high-volume data transfer and storage system based on STM32F407 microcontroller, and it’s design principles, selection basis and hardware circuit of the various functional modules.2. Lwip/udp protocol optimization bringing Fast Ethernet data transmission.3. bettering UDP protocol security Ethernet data transmission.4. the use of the STM32own Mass storage firmware library implements high-speed USB storage function.5. by transplantation of file system FatFs to achieve the U disk data management.Finally, the paper discusses the system’s debuging and testing, proved the feasibility of the system design, which can meet the stability of high-performance data transfer and storage.
Keywords/Search Tags:Embedded Data transmission and storage systems, STM32F407low power consumption, USB host, LwIP/udp
PDF Full Text Request
Related items